Igbo youths blow hot over attack on Ifeanyi Ubah’s convoy

The Coalition of South East Youth Leaders, COSEYL, has frowned at the attack on Senator Ifeanyi Ubah’s convoy at Enugwu Ukwu junction in Njikoka Local Government Area of Anambra State.

Recall that the attack on the politician’s private convoy on Sunday around Nkwo Enugwu Ukwu Market in Anambra, while the lawmaker was on his way to his country home, had led to the death of his aides and security agents accompanying him.

Reacting, COSEYL, in a statement issued on Monday by its President General, Goodluck Ibem said the attack was triggered by “something fishy”, asking the law enforcement agencies to uncover the circumstances surrounding the attack.

The statement reads, “We are really pained and disheartened to receive this heartbreaking news of how our youths lost their lives in broad daylight. What a wicked world.

“It is infelicitous that such senseless killing of innocent youths who have done nothing wrong is happening in Igboland, the zone that was known to be very peaceful.

“Something is fishy in this very attack and we demand that security agencies must unravel those hoodlums and their sponsors behind the assassination attempt on the life of Senator Ubah and bring them to justice.

“This vicious attack and assassination of our youths is a confirmation that enemies of Ndigbo have crept into our midst and they must be fished out by all means”.
